Bushwacker Origin
The bushwacker is a frozen cocktail made with rum, coffee, and lotion of coconut. The drink has a milkshake-like texture and is typically garnished with whipped lotion and grated nutmeg.


The mixed drink came from 1975 at the Ship's Shop on St. Thomas in the United State Virgin Islands. It then migrated to Florida, where it was promoted by Linda Murphy at the Sandshaker Coastline Bar in Pensacola Beach.

The initial bushwacker was produced in 1975 at the Ship's Store & Sapphire Pub on St. Thomas in the Virgin Islands by Angie Conigliaro and Tom Brokamp. The drink was named after a visitor's droopy-eared Covering dog called "Bushwack." It ultimately made its method stateside thanks to Linda Taylor Murphy, the owner of Pensacola's Sandshaker Beach Bar.

Variants
A bushwacker is a drink that feels like a delicious chocolate milkshake or smoothie, yet it's created grownups. It's a mixed cocktail made with dark rum, coffee liqueur, creme de cacao, and coconut cream. It's a tropical fave at yacht charters coastline bars, however it can be easily made at home.

It's occasionally offered with a sprinkle of triple sec for a citrus spin, yet that alters the original intent of the drink. It's additionally often served with a shot of amaretto, which is a fantastic enhancement to the beverage, but it does include an additional layer of sweetness. Some dishes require bottled pina colada mix to be utilized instead of the lotion of coconut, but this includes a bit much more pineapple taste that's not in the initial intended preference of the beverage.

The name of the drink is a referral to the bushwhackers, which are a kind of American Civil War guerillas that declined to pick sides. It's unclear why the name was chosen, yet it's a fitting name for this wild and free-spirited drink.
